#e6aef8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e6aef8 is composed of 90.2% red, 68.2%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.3%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 82.7%. #e6aef8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d5df1.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

#e6aef8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e6aef8 has RGB values of R:230, G:174,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 15118072.

Shades and Tints of #e6aef8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070109 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6aef8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d0d6 is the less saturated color, while #e9a7ff is the most saturated one.
